Vorderseite: NORFOLK AND SUFFOLK TOKEN - ONE SHILLING. Das Wappen von Yarmouth zwischen Eichenzweigen.
Rückseite: PAYABLE AT J. HUNTONS YARMOUTH & AT BLYTH & CO. BURY [O hochgestellt über Punkt]. Das Wappen von Bury St. Edmunds zwischen Lorbeerzweig und Palmwedel. Darunter 1811.
Rand: Kerbrand
Literatur: R. Dalton, The Silver Token-Coinage mainly issued between 1811 and 1812 (1922) 22 Nr. 15; W. J. Davis, The Nineteenth Century Token coinage of Great Britain Ireland the Channel Islands and the Isle of Man to which are added Tokens over one Penny value of any period (1904/Nachdruck 1969) 82 Nr. 14; A. W. Waters, Notes on the Silver Tokens of the Nineteenth Century (1957) 9 unter Yarmouth; P. und B. R. Withers, The Token Book. British Tokens of the 17th 18th and 19th centuries and their values (2010) 405 Nr. 14-15.
